Research and Evidence Behind Smart Balance Training
A growing body of research supports the benefits of balance training and the use of digital tools to deliver it. Exercise-based balance programs are well established in reducing falls and improving stability. More recent randomized controlled trials and systematic reviews indicate that sensor-guided and app-delivered balance training can equal or improve outcomes versus traditional programs by offering greater repetition, immediate feedback and higher adherence. Tele-rehabilitation trials also show that remotely supervised, technology-enabled programs can produce outcomes comparable to in-person therapy for many patients, particularly when objective metrics and clinician dashboards are included.
Exercise-based balance training reduces fall risk and improves mobility; systematic reviews and meta-analyses support these outcomes.
Randomized controlled trials show that sensor-enabled training with real-time feedback often increases training dose and adherence compared with unsupervised home programs.
Tele-rehabilitation studies indicate similar functional outcomes to face-to-face therapy for many balance and vestibular conditions when guided programs and remote monitoring are used.
Wearable inertial sensors and force-platform devices used in clinical studies have demonstrated acceptable accuracy for quantifying sway, step parameters and progression metrics.
Objective metrics from smart devices help clinicians measure improvement, set evidence-based progression targets and document outcomes for referrals, reimbursement or research.
